  • Is it OK to exercise after an adjustment?

    Hello, I strongly encourage my patients to workout after their adjustments. Adjustments mobilize (move) spinal joints, which increases mobility and reduces pressure on nerves. Less pressure on nerves should mean better nerve flow, which ultimately means better nervous system function, so a more effective workout. Sincerely, Dr. Duchon READ MORE

  • Is it normal to feel worse after chiropractor?

    Hello, Normal, no, common yes. Soft tissue, muscle, tendons and ligaments that help stabilize the spine are also “moved” during an adjustment, meaning their lengths and resting positions are altered. You may feel like you got a deep massage or started a new workout program which is common. Sincerely, Dr. Duchon READ MORE
